Résumé
The most represented histotype of testicular cancer is the testicular germ-cell tumor (TGCT), both seminoma and non-seminoma. The pathogenesis of this cancer is poorly known. A possible causal relationship between viral infections and TGCTs was firstly evoked almost 40 years ago and is still a subject of debate. In the recent past, different authors have argued about a possible role of specific viruses in the development of TGCTs including human papillomavirus (HPV), Epstein-Barr virus (EBV), cytomegalovirus (CMV), Parvovirus B-19, and human immunodeficiency virus (HIV). The aim of this present review was to summarize, for each virus considered, the available evidence on the impact of viral infections on the risk of developing TGCTs. The review was reported following the Preferred Reporting Items for Systematic Reviews and Meta-Analyses (PRISMA) guidelines. We included all observational studies reported in English evaluating the correlations between viral infections (HPV, CMV, EBV, Parvovirus B19, and HIV) and TGCTs. The methodological quality of studies included in the meta-analysis was evaluated using a modified version of the "Newcastle-Ottawa Scale." Meta-analyses were conducted using the "Generic inverse variance" method, where a pooled odds ratio (OR) was determined from the natural logarithm (LN) of the studies' individual OR [LN (OR)] and the 95% CI. A total of 20 studies (on 265,057 patients) were included in the review. Meta-analysis showed an association with TGCTs only for some of the explored viruses.
